Tutorial: Torus Möbius

Here are the steps I did to make this model.

Start by opening a new sketch. I made my part in mm,

As the name suggests, this shape is just a torus cut in half with a möbius (still a single solid body)

  1. Step 1:

    Start a new sketch on the top plane.

  2. Step 2:

    This first sketch will be the path for the torus. Make the center coincident to the origin with a diameter of 100mm,

    Exit this sketch.

    I called this sketch "Path Circle"

  3. Step 3:

    Open a new sketch on the right plane.

  4. Step 4:

    Now create the profile for the torus.

    Make a circle with a diameter of 50mm and pierce the center to the "Path Circle."
    Exit this sketch.

    I called this sketch "Torus Profile"

  5. Step 5:

    In a new sketch on the top plane create an arc. This arc needs to be collinear to the "Path Circle" and the end points should be vertical to the origin. This arc is the left half of the circle.
    exit this sketch

    I called this sketch "Left half"

  6. Step 6:

    create a new sketch on the top plane and again create an arc the same a the previous step but this time for the right half of the circle.
    exit this sketch.

    I called this sketch "Right half"

  7. Step 7:

    Create a sketch on the right plane and make a "Center Rectangle" with the center pierced to the "Path Circle", one of the vertical lines tangent to the "Torus Profile" with a height of 20mm.
    Exit this sketch.

    I called this sketch "Mobius profile"

  8. Step 8:

    Using the Sweep Boss/Base feature, create the torus by selecting the "Torus profile " and "Path circle" sketches.
    Accept using green check.

  9. Step 9:

    Here is our torus that we now need to cut with a mobius.

  10. Step 10:

    Use the cut sweep feature and select the "Mobius profile" and "Left half" sketches. Now under options choose "Twist Along Path" and set the angel to 90deg.
    Click the green check to accept.

  11. Step 11:

    This cut will create a number of solid bodies that we do not want. A message box will appear and ask what bodies we would like to keep. choose the Selected bodies option and click on the top body. The portion of the torus that we want to keep should turn blue. Click OK.

  12. Step 12:

    Now repeat step 10 but choose the right half sketch for the path and click the button with the circular arrows on it to the left of the degrees. This changes the direction of the twist.

  13. Step 13:

    Repeat step 11.

  14. Step 14:

    Add a fillet of 5mm to the two edges.

  15. Step 15:

    And now we have a cool Torus Mobius.
